I picked mine up at NAPA yesterday. $6.69 each. I snagged 4 of them. No gaskets though. Number 1153 NAPA Gold. Baldwin filters were also on sale for $8.02 each I think.
 
think if you look at the new filters they might have a nice surprise, wix made these forever but china bought them up, new 1153 I got were made by baldwin and says made in USA and no gasket
